BUSINESS
PROCESS REVIEW
AND
BUSINESS
PROCESS DECISION DOCUMENTATION
The PeopleSoft Advancement Functional Lead (Associate
Director of DEA Operations and Director of Special Projects) provides
consultation services to help customers review their business processes to
increase their efficiency and to make better use of PeopleSoft Advancement and
other administrative systems. Assistance is available in identifying needs,
defining the scope, developing solutions and timelines, and monitoring
progress.
If it is determined that an identified need within
PeopleSoft cannot be met, there are three options:
- Re-engineer the current business practice to fit within
PeopleSoft functionality
- Request a modification of PeopleSoft to meet the
identified need
- Develop a non-PeopleSoft solution (a work-around) to
meet the identified need
To request a modification of PeopleSoft, the following
steps occur:
- The Functional Lead will present the need to the IMPACT
team (Operations functional and technical staff) for approval to proceed with
the request.
- Once approval is given, a “BPD”, or Business Process
Decision Document must be completed. For the template click:
Business Process Decision Document template.
The Functional Lead will work with the customer to develop the request and
will provide the technical information needed (tables and fields) by the
technical team.
- The customer will
assist in determining the amount of time and money that will be saved by the
modification.
- The completed BPD is presented to IMPACT for review.
- The Module Lead shares the BPD with the other Module
Leads for their information and possible input.
- The Technical Lead
will look at the proposed modification and will determine the costs to develop
and implement it, including ongoing costs of maintenance.
- The completed BPD
is forwarded to the Steering Committee, who decides whether to approve.
- If approved, the
Module Lead for Advancement reviews it and the other modification requests
with the Technical Team to assign a priority.
- The Technical Team
works on the modification (this can be a week to 6 months in duration,
depending upon the complexity and priority).
- The customer as
well as the Functional Lead will assign staff to test the modification.
- When testing is
complete and any errors are corrected, the modification is moved to
Production.
